Air France wins 8th place at 2025 Skytrax World Airline Awards, wins Best Airline in Western Europe
Events
Webp benjamin smith
Benjamin Smith, CEO of Air France | Pierre36217867 (Wikipedia Commons)

Air France announced it ranked eighth in the 2025 Skytrax World Airline Awards and received honors for Best Airline in Western Europe, World's Best First Class Comfort Amenities, and World's Best First Class Lounge Dining for its Paris CDG Terminal 2 lounge.

According to the World Airline Awards, Air France earned recognition at the 2025 Skytrax World Airline Awards, climbing to 8th place globally, a one-position rise from the previous year. The awards ceremony was held at the Paris Air Show in Le Bourget and celebrated excellence in aviation, with Air France distinguishing itself among more than 325 airlines. In addition to its top 10 global ranking, Air France was honored as the Best Airline in Western Europe, reinforcing its dominance in the regional market and its commitment to service quality and innovation.

Air France received two product-specific accolades: World's Best First Class Comfort Amenities and World's Best First Class Lounge Dining for its lounge at Paris Charles de Gaulle's Terminal 2, according to the release. These awards show the airline's efforts to elevate the luxury travel experience, with standout features such as refined in-flight bedding and top-tier culinary offerings in its exclusive lounges.

Air France posted on X: "We’re thrilled to have secured the 8th position at the 2025 Skytrax World Airline Awards, and to have been named Best Airline in Western Europe for yet another consecutive year! Thank you to all our clients and teams for these awards!"

The national airline of France is a founding member of the SkyTeam global alliance, operating from its primary hub at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port. Renowned for its commitment to elegance, innovation, and high-quality service, Air France serves destinations across six continents with a strong emphasis on premium travel experiences.
